Bruno Haible scripsit:
> Because some users, especially in Europe, are still in an ISO-8859-x locale.
> I can only estimate it: between 10% and 30%, I guess. If they look at UTF-8
> encoded PO files for their language in a normal text editor, they see only
> garbage.
I don't see the relevance of that. If you view any non-ASCII file using
a dumb (non-locale-sensitive) text editor, you will see mojibake unless
your locale's encoding matches the file's.
Currently, there is a rule "if no encoding header and has high-bit
bytes, then error"; I'm proposing changing that to "if no encoding
header and has high-bit bytes, then UTF-8". Files in other encodings
with headers are not affected; files in other encodings without errors
are bogus anyway.
